Family: Fabaceae
Pultenaea canaliculata var. canaliculata
Citation:
Synonymy: Not Applicable Common name: None
Description:
Leaves conduplicate, upper surface hidden, gradually attenuate into the petiole so as to appear terete and slightly clavate, recurved gently in the middle portion, the apex straight; flowers mostly purplish, standard red on the back, if yellow then streaked red.

Distribution:
|
In S.Aust. it occurs inland while in Vic. it is coastal (Corrick, 1976).
Vic.
|
Flowering time: June — Jan.
